Cricket
Mumbai: The BCCI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) has changed the dates of the Ranji Trophy Super League and Plate semifinals and the final. As per the revised schedule, the Super League semifinals will be held from January 23 to 27 instead of January 18 to 22. The final will be played from February 2 to 6 instead of January 27 to 31. ``We have changed the date as the final is being telecast live,'' BCCI's Chief Administrative Officer, Ratnakar Shetty, said on Saturday. The Plate semifinals would now be held from January 10 to 14 and the final from January 21 to 25, Shetty added.
Venue shifted
Meanwhile, the Deodhar Trophy inter-zonal limited-over cricket tournament has been shifted to Mumbai from North Zone and would be played from February 24 to March 10, the BCCI announced on Saturday. ``The shift in venue has been done because one of the North Zone centres, Mohali, is not available due to repair work at the stadium,'' Shetty said. The tournament will be played on a round-robin basis among the five zones. PTI
